BP Affirms Sealed Macondo Well Not Leaking

BPAccording to a statement by the U. S. Coast Guard, a film of oil floating on waters of Gulf of Mexico has been discovered, which is being suspected to be due to oil leaking from a 100-ton device, which was deployed by BP after many weeks of the oil spill disaster in 2010.

Oil Prices Rise after Fed’s Announcement of Stimulus Program

Oil-Prices-RiseA recent report has uncovered that he U. S. Federal Reserve’s new program aimed at enhancing and boosting the economy has also resulted in an increase in oil.

The Program was launched on Thursday, which has also caused Brent futures to augment a sixth session. The same includes buying $40 billion of mortgage debt each month or atleast until the time job-outlook improves.

Federal Nuclear Regulatory Commission Approves 2 Nuclear Reactors in Georgia

NuclearAs per reports, it has been revealed the Southern Co. has got green signal from the federal Nuclear Regulatory Commission to build two new nuclear reactors in Georgia. It is great news for nuclear industry as it will be the second nuclear plant which is going to build in the world after Fukushima’s incident.
